Inhomogeneous Jacobi matrices on trees

Functional Analysis 2016-05-12 v1

Abstract

We study Jacobi matrices on trees with one end at inifinity. We show that the defect indices cannot be greater than 1 and give criteria for essential selfadjointness. We construct certain polynomials associated with matrices, which mimic orthogonal polynomials in the classical case. Nonnegativity of Jacobi matrices is studied as well.
